StepDescriptionDetails & Tips
Plan the RouteDetermine the best route from the main house water line to the detached garagePlan the shortest, most direct path; check underground obstacles; select connection point
Digging/ExcavationDig a trench underground along the planned routeTrench depth typically below frost line (e.g., 12-18 inches or deeper depending on local code)
Pipe SelectionChoose pipe type suitable for underground water lineCommon options: 1” CTS polyethylene (polly) pipe rated for pressure, PEX tubing in conduit
Installation of PipeLay pipe in the trench and run it to the garageAvoid joints under concrete slab; use tracer wire and caution tape above pipe in trench
Connections and FixturesConnect new pipe to the main house supply and install shutoff valves, fixtures, and ventingInstalling valves near garage; consider frost-free spigots; follow local plumbing codes
Protection and BackfillProtect the pipe with proper materials (clay or sand) and backfill the trenchAdd bentonite clay around pipe for sealing; mark location with caution tape
Permits and CodesObtain necessary permits and follow local plumbing and zoning regulationsCheck local codes for installation depth, pipe material, and sewer connection restrictions
Additional ConsiderationsPlan for electrical conduit if needed; consider water pressure and future plumbing upgradesRun electrical wiring in separate conduit; test water pressure; add pumps if necessary

Determining the best route for your water line

Choosing the right route for your water line is crucial. Start by surveying the area between your main supply and the garage. Look for obstacles like trees, sidewalks, or foundations.

Consider underground utilities first. You don’t want to accidentally hit a buried cable or pipe during installation. Call local utility services to mark these lines before digging.

Next, think about slope and drainage. A downhill path can help with gravity flow, but may require extra precautions against freezing in colder climates.

Plan for accessibility as well. Your water line should be easy to reach if repairs are needed later on. Keeping it away from heavy foot traffic minimizes wear and tear, too.

Check local building codes that dictate specific routes or depth requirements for water lines in your area. This ensures compliance and safety throughout your project.

Tools and materials needed

To successfully run a water line to your detached garage, having the right tools and materials is essential. Start with PVC or PEX pipes, which are durable and suitable for underground installation.

You’ll also need fittings like elbows and tees to navigate around obstacles in your yard. Don’t forget valves to control water flow easily.

A shovel or trenching tool will be necessary for digging trenches where the pipe will lie. A tape measure helps ensure you’re digging at the correct depth.

For connections, get some plumber’s tape and joint compound; these prevent leaks where pipes join together. Additionally, have a hacksaw handy for cutting pipes to size.

Safety gear such as gloves and goggles can protect you from potential hazards during installation. Gathering these items beforehand streamlines the process significantly.

Step-by-step instructions for installing the water line

First, turn off the main water supply to your home. This will prevent any mishaps while you work on the installation.

Next, dig a trench from your house to the garage. Aim for about 12-18 inches deep to protect the line from freezing temperatures.

Once you’ve cleared the path, lay down a bed of sand or gravel in the bottom of the trench. This provides extra cushioning for your new pipe.

Now it’s time to install PVC or PEX piping. Cut sections as needed and connect them using appropriate fittings and glue where necessary.

Be sure to include a shut-off valve near the garage entrance for easy access in case of emergencies.

After laying everything out, carefully backfill the trench with soil, ensuring there are no sharp objects that could damage your water line later on.

Tips for avoiding common mistakes

When running a water line to your detached garage, preparation is key. Before you start digging, check for existing underground utilities. Hitting a gas line or electrical cable can lead to costly repairs and safety hazards.

Always choose the right type of pipe for your climate. PVC may be fine in warmer areas, but if you live somewhere that experiences freezing temperatures, opt for PEX or copper pipes instead. These materials won’t crack as easily under pressure from ice.

Consider the slope of the ground when laying down your water line. A slight downward gradient helps with drainage and prevents any potential backups.

Double-check all connections before burying your lines. Tighten fittings and ensure there are no leaks to avoid future headaches that come with damage or excess moisture around your property.

Connecting the water line to your garage’s plumbing system

Once your water line reaches the garage, it’s time to connect it to your existing plumbing system. Start by ensuring you have the right fittings compatible with both your new line and the current setup.

Turn off the main water supply before beginning any connections. This will prevent unnecessary leaks or spills during installation.

Use a T-fitting if you’re branching off from an existing line within the garage. Securely tighten all joints using appropriate paste or tape for added protection against leaks.

If you are adding a faucet or utility sink, ensure that drain lines are adequately installed as well. Proper drainage is essential to avoid standing water issues later on.

After making all connections, slowly turn on the main supply again while checking for any signs of leakage at every joint. Address any leaks immediately to maintain integrity in your system.

Troubleshooting and maintenance tips

Regularly check for leaks along the water line. A small drip can turn into a major issue if left unattended. Use a towel to dry any suspicious spots, then monitor them over several days.

Pay attention to the pressure of your water supply. If it fluctuates or drops suddenly, there might be an obstruction or a broken pipe somewhere along the line.

Keep insulation in mind during colder months. Frozen pipes can burst and cause significant damage. Insulating materials around exposed sections will help prevent this problem.

Flush out your system at least once a year to remove sediment buildup that could slow down flow rates and affect overall efficiency.

If you notice unusual noises when using fixtures connected to your garage’s plumbing, investigate immediately; these sounds often indicate air trapped in the lines or other issues needing prompt attention.
